How & why

Son of a mother of Alsatian Jewish origin, Alexandre Millerand was a lawyer for strikers before he was a statesman. In 1899 he became the first socialist to sit in a European government, and as minister of commerce he wrote the laws that cut the working day and created labour inspection. He was prime minister in 1920 and then President of the French Republic until 1924 — the first French head of state of Jewish descent.
